There are a variety of ways to get citizenship in the United States in order to legally work and live in Port Orange, Florida. If you were born in the United States and your birth was registered with the appropriate authorities, you are a citizen of the United States. This is by far the most common means of becoming an United States citizen.

Individuals not born in Florida, or any other state within the Union can apply for Citizenship through the procedure of naturalization. This generally means fulfilling a list of requirements in order to become a citizen. These requirements vary depending on the applicant. Generally, everyone must be a legal permanent resident, reside in the country for a certain period of time, pass a test on U.S. history and law, and maintain good moral character.
